Following last years front and rear facelifts, updated engine and upgraded feature set, Toyota decided to change a feature thats been plaguing Rav4 fans everywhere.

What was the biggest complaint about old Rav4 models? Well, of course, it was the spare tire hanging off the side-hinged tailgate. In Europe and some Asian markets, the RAV4 has been offered without the spare tire for a few years now, but the Japanese manufacturer inexplicably kept it on the RAV4 in American markets. Last years model began offering a Sport Appearance Package for RAV4 vehicles that finally brought a much more sophisticated and street-savvy look for North American drivers. The package, which helped redefine the look of the car, including new features like run-flat tires, chrome exhaust tip, special badging, heated leather seats, cargo mat, leather door trim and more interior chrome brightwork. The unfortunate reality of these new features was that they were only available for a specific trim: the V6 Sport. But for 2010, Toyota has decided to extend that availability to all RAV4 Sport models, a move that is probably indicative of a significantly positive consumer response to the RAV4 V6 Sport changes. And best of all, the package costs the same this year as it did last year a minimal $577.
